Finally the day had arrived where everyone was at least adequately dressed for a challenge. Then again, once in wolf form we are all dressed the same. It was another beautiful gray morning. A light fog covered the dewy grass where soon there would be an all out brawl. I looked around and saw even Oakley looked nervous about what was to come. 

"This is the challenge you have all been waiting for!" the Luna Mother announced to the group of about 14 remaining challengers. Soon to be seven. They shuffled nervously in place. 

"Now we would greatly regret having to put any one of you in the ground tonight so please do us all a favor and abstain from killing blows whenever possible." She announced. Very comforting. 

"Remember a Luna must be fierce and strong and might have to fight people off to protect her pack," her eyes met mine for a moment, "We are hoping to see that perseverance and determination from you all today. Each of you will be assigned a partner and depending on what happens here one of you will stay and the other will be going home. To the half going home, we thank you humbly for your participation."

First up was Rayven and a wolf I didn't know, a scary looking redhead. It was a shockingly polite match because it was the first. They both had a lot of nerves to get out of there system, but also hadn't seen anyone else go yet and didn't want to go too far and draw blood. I swear Rayvens opponent may have been shaking and it was quickly over before it began and Rayven was declared the winner of a good clean fight. 

"Its not so bad," she said coming up to Jules and I out of breath, "I can't believe it's already over. I did it." We both gave her a congratulatory pat on the back, but we were too nervous to feel really happy yet. The second match was between two wolves I didn't know, but I felt like I knew them by the time it was finally over. It was long, cruel and didn't feel fair. There was scratching and hair pulling and even a rock thrown, but the Luna Mother said nothing as we gasped and flinched at each new attack. When finally the winner was declared the other wolf was taken off the field in a stretcher to go to the med room.

"Fight with honor is for the males. If you ever have to find yourself in a fight as a she-wolf you shouldn't hold anything back." She said simply in explanation. My face hardened. A Luna never gives up. Dandilion was picked next and to my horror she was set to spar against Oakley. She gave me one nod as if she had accepted her date and transformed into her black and gray wolf. Oakley transformed as well into her warm brown wolf. I could hardly bare to watch. Dandilion must have been paying attention to the last match because she dodged Oakley's first attack and gave Oakley a long scratch down her side as she passed. Oakley turned and fury filled her eyes as she let out a vicious growl. Dandilion backed off a little bit and Oakley took the opportunity to lunge again and knock Dani onto her back. I held my breath as Dani struggled and bit at her assailant, but she just didn't have the muscle. I looked away as I heard the crunch of bone. The match was called when Dani could no longer stand and Oakley was glowing with pride. The long line of blood dripping from her body hardly seemed to bother her as she strutted past us. She'll pay for this one day. I ran to the stretcher where Dani, now in human form, was being dragged off the field. 

"Are you ok," I asked stupidly looking at her shattered arm and shoulder.

"I'll be fine, it was always going to end like this," Dani replied through gritted teeth, "Remember the promise you made me." 

"I remember, " I said as they pulled her away to go set her arm. Hopefully they wouldn't send her home for a couple weeks until she could walk again. 

"Up next is Elma and Trina," the Luna Mother announced. I turned and met the soft blue eyes of a strawberry blonde wolf. Now it was her or me.
